CBRE Group Q2 2026 Revenue Meets Analyst Expectations
CBRE Group, Inc. has reported its financial results for the second quarter of the 2026 calendar year, revealing that the company’s revenue aligned with market forecasts. The commercial real estate services giant continues to navigate a complex landscape across its global operations, which include advisory services, building operations, project management, and real estate investments.
While specific earnings figures were the primary focus of the announcement, the confirmation that revenue hit expected targets suggests stability in the firm’s core business segments. CBRE operates extensively in the United States, the United Kingdom, and internationally, providing a buffer against regional market fluctuations. The company’s diversified business model ranges from strategic advisory roles to the tangible management of physical assets.
In the current market session, CBRE shares are reacting positively. The stock is trading at $150.20, representing an increase of 0.54% from the previous close of $149.39. This movement reflects investor sentiment following the news release. The company currently holds a market capitalization of approximately $40.84 billion, maintaining its position as a significant player within the Real Estate Services sector.
